WebFeb 9, 2024 · Legal Separation. A Legal Separation is a legal action filed by a married person or domestic partner who wants to stay married or in the domestic partnership, but also wants to resolve all other issues, such as child custody, child and spousal support and property division. WebJan 3, 2024 · By Divorce.com staff. Updated Jan 03, 2024. The divorce process in California will take at least six months. California divorce law contains a mandatory waiting period. That means a California court will not issue a divorce decree until six months after filing the divorce petition.

WebJan 18, 2024 · The first consideration in filing for divorce in California is the residency requirement. In order to file for divorce in California, the filing spouse must have resided in the state for at least six months and in the county were the divorce paperwork is filed for at least three months.
